The first prototypes developed by Krauss-Maffei were delivered for testing in 1972. The 1973 Yom Kippur War between Israel and Egypt highlighted the importance of armoured protection, and the Leopard 2 developed into a much more heavily armoured vehicle than its predecessor, the Leopard 1. Its composite armour, incorporating layers of materials with different protective characteristics, improved its protection against a variety of anti-tank warheads, while retaining its predecessor's extraordinary speed.
